Rozycki" To: =?utf-8?q?Ilpo_J=C3=A4rvinen?= , Matthew W Carlis , Bjorn Helgaas cc: Mika Westerberg , Oliver O'Halloran , linux-pci@vger.kernel.org, linux-kernel@vger.kernel.org Subject: [PATCH v3 0/4] PCI: Rework error reporting with PCIe failed link retraining Message-ID: User-Agent: Alpine 2.21 (DEB 202 2017-01-01) Precedence: bulk X-Mailing-List: linux-pci@vger.kernel.org List-Id: List-Subscribe: List-Unsubscribe: MIME-Version: 1.0 Hi, This is a minor update to the patch series posted here: which includes a change to 2/4 suggested by Ilpo to wait on LT rather than DLLLA with the recovery call to `pcie_retrain_link' in the failure path, so as to avoid an excessive delay where we expect training to fail anyway. This patch series addresses issues observed by Ilpo as reported here: , one with excessive delays happening when `pcie_failed_link_retrain' is called, but link retraining has not been actually attempted, and another one with an API misuse caused by a merge mistake. It also addresses an issue observed by Matthew as discussed here: and here: . where a stale LBMS bit state causes `pcie_failed_link_retrain', in the absence of a downstream device, to leave the link stuck at the 2.5GT/s speed rate, which then negatively impacts devices plugged in in the future.
